The surname "Tadeu" has its roots in ancient Roman and Greek cultures. The name is derived from the Latin name "Thaddeus," which means "heart" or "courageous." It was a popular name among early Christians and is associated with one of the twelve apostles, Judas Thaddeus. Over time, the name evolved into different variations, including "Thaddeus" and "Tadeo" in Spanish-speaking countries. The surname "Tadeu" is believed to have originated in Portugal and Spain before spreading to other parts of the world through colonial expeditions and trade routes.
According to data collected from various countries, the surname "Tadeu" is most prevalent in Brazil, with an incidence of 2,499 individuals. This indicates a strong presence of the Tadeu family in Brazilian society, reflecting the country's diverse population and cultural heritage. In Angola, the surname is also quite common, with 2,366 individuals carrying the name. Portugal has a relatively lower incidence of the surname, with 632 individuals bearing the Tadeu name. In France, the Tadeu surname is less common, with only 82 individuals identified with the name. The surname also has a presence in Mozambique, Zimbabwe, and the United States, with 49, 47, and 46 individuals respectively. While the Tadeu surname is less prevalent in countries like Cameroon, Canada, and Spain, it still has a notable presence with 14, 11, and 9 individuals respectively.
